I think if you were to ask a consensus of boxing writers via e-mail which promoters tend to take smaller percentages of the revenues the bigger promoters probably take smaller percentages on their biggest events. Small events are roughly equal for just about all promoters.
The biggest events in the US these days are generally done by either Golden Boy and Top Rank with the occasional exception of DiBella and Goosen-Tudor. But I've read many interviews on other sites where Golden Boy was agreed to have been the one that takes a smaller percentage of revenues than Top Rank. Part of that is because Golden Boy usually allows fighters to have more control over their own careers; which leads to some calls that they're more of a "booking agent" rather than a "real promoter."
A lot of people don't like Golden Boy's model because it's so decentralized. Image control is a problem. Look at how well Top Rank protects its fighter's images. It doesn't matter why Top Rank fighters don't sign for fights...it's never their fault. They're always tough guys. But, generally speaking of course, Golden Boy allows it's fighters more control, business interests and a higher percentage of revenues.
Again, a lot of old-timers don't like this. The notion that promoters work for the fighters is not popular, but it's central to Golden Boy's business model. That said, I have no idea what percentages Top Rank makes on Pacquiao, Lopez, Cotto, etc. Or what percentages Golden Boy will make on Khan, Alvarez, etc. I just know that in interviews and editorials I've read it's been generally agreed upon that Hopkins, Mosley, Hatton, etc. get an unusually large percentage of revenues on their fights.Comment
